03/10/10 Wednesday's Results
During Rounds this morning we were told that two tests were back. One of the outstanding genetic tests came back and it was normal. Patricia and I aren't sure what this particular genetic test was supposed to cover since it wasn't one we were keeping an eye out for but it was normal so we're not too worried. We were also told that Eli's third ceruloplasmin test was back. This latest test was sent off to a lab in Chicago after the previous two tests came back with scores in the "less than 13" category. Whatever lab they were using previously couldn't measure the results at a level lower than 13 so we've been worrying about an "abnormal" result. Ceruloplasmin is a measure of copper carrying proteins in the blood. An abnormal result can indicate a copper deficiency and copper deficiencies are particularly bad. The result from the lab in Chicago indicated a ceruloplasmin level of 11 with normal being in the range of 8+. It turns out Eli is in the normal range which is a good sign. We are still waiting for final confirmation on the Menke's genetic test but we feel better that his copper tests are now being characterized as normal.
